You are the Mediatrix in union with Christ, from Whom your mediation draws all its power. the lick in f majorWebSorrowful Mystery of the Rosary. Tuesday & Friday. The Agony of Jesus in the Garden. Jesus prays when confronted with the sins of the world. The Scourging at the Pillar. Jesus is whipped before His execution. Jesus is Crowned with Thorns. Jesus is mocked with a painful crown of thorns. The Apostles’ Creed the licking miami beach flWebThe Scriptural Rosary centers attention on a scriptural passage from the life of Jesus to reflect on while praying the Hail Mary. The Scriptural Rosary is a modern version of the way the Rosary was prayed in the late Middle Ages. In those days, between 1425 to 1525 A.D., people recited a different meditation before they said each Hail Mary. tiburon ergonomic chair
